Default Govan - loving his work

Unless there is a major earthquake or disaster Govan will most likely to be up for eviction. Now as much as I dislike the little turd is good value.

Govan is the only person at the moment who is stirring this up he has managed to caused two arguments is the space of five minute tonight. He's also managed off load most of that blame on to Ben.

Now I don't if it by design or he just has the knack of deflecting any responsiblilty for the chaos he causes but on the whole it a good thing that he is still in there.

We need some like him in there the void after Rachael left was deafening the housemates all thought and felt it, and as a l/f viewer I too thought the mood of the house was becoming boring.

Govan tonight had managed to have the whole house in uproar and he even got a sympathay hug for Josie when it all ended. As much as I would like him to go, I think he should stay for now.
